Medical Device Maker Cuts Cycle Times, Runs Unattended with Methods Plus K60
SpiTrex MDI had more orders on the way, but their floor set up was not ready to adapt. Rather than invest in more standalone 3-axis machines, the team sought a new solution that would reduce cycle times, enable unmanned machining, and have the power and reliability to cut harder materials like titanium. With the Methods Plus K60, built upon the FANUC RoboDrill, SpiTrex has the machine it needs for trusted, high-volume production.
